Guys, You Need To Sharpen The Message A Little

L. Brent Bozell’s Media Research Center broadcasts the following terrifying action-alert:

CBS Plugs France’s Paid Maternity Leave, Subsidized Child Care

Saturday’s CBS Evening News featured a story, filed by correspondent Sheila MacVicar, which highlighted the French government’s policy of entitling all mothers to three years of paid maternity leave and subsidized child care as a way to increase the birth rate and thus provide more young taxpayers to pay for the pensions of the elderly. MacVicar pointed out that in America, “federal law entitles some working mothers to twelve weeks unpaid leave,” before cautioning that “the rest get nothing.” MacVicar relayed that French women enjoy more benefits than their American counterparts: “Take a look at what all French families, regardless of income, are entitled to: Up to three years paid maternity leave with a guarantee that mom’s job will be there for her when she returns. There’s subsidized child care, a whole host of tax credits, and for baby number three brings twice the government allowance of baby number two.”

OMG. Like, eek.

This is Republican dog-whistle politics in transition from its high-baroque period — in which operatives like Bozell whipped up gales of conservative spite among their low-information constituencies, against teh socialist MSM cheese-eating liberal-elitist John Kerry media surrender-frogs of teh foreign French Democrat Party — to a new, gestural stage in which we’re apparently supposed to understand, prima facie, that maternity leave and child care are Frenchbad.
